Hi. For some strange reason, my Search /Find/find What/results are not coming up. When I click on the Find All the Search box only flashes one time, no matter what "Limit to:" I choose from the drop down. From what I can recall I have not changed any of my settings. Please help. Thx.

5000 search.JPG
 
Did you try checking the Wrap checkbox? Unless you start at rung 0 of the main routine you might not find your search request. The search direction is set for down. It will only search down from your current location in program. It would not find RESET if it was above your current location.
 
And with the current Limit To, it is only searching for a tag with the exact name of "reset". I know you said you have tried other Limit To options.

The Wrap option is probably the issue.

Have you once used multiple monitors and draaged the un-docked search results window onto the second screen?

Try starting the Logix5000 application with the Shift key pressed and held. This will reset the GUI to factory defaults. You will lose any colour changes you may have made, along with any options like the Start Page turned off etc.

Have you once used multiple monitors and draaged the un-docked search results window onto the second screen?

Yep! that's what the problem was. Thanks! The strange thing about it is is that I still had multiple screens hooked up and the results window was "still" way off screen. Do you use a method to keep that from happening?
 
Do you use a method to keep that from happening?

Nope, I don't use a second monitor very often, but when I do I just make sure I don't leave anything on the secondary screen when I close the application.
